The Mango Farm

The Mango Farm is more than a live music event, it is a carefully cultivated cultural experience rooted in community, intimacy, and the celebration of alternative African sound. Focused on Neo Soul and R&B, the platform creates space for emerging artists to be seen, heard, and deeply felt. Through BAI Foundation’s support, The Mango Farm has grown into a powerful example of how grassroots creativity can evolve into meaningful cultural impact.

An Intimate World Built for Connection
An Intimate World Built for Connection

Hosted in an unconventional warehouse setting, The Mango Farm transformed an industrial space into something deeply personal. With soft carpets, scattered cushions, and a circular stage at its centre, the environment invited audiences to sit, lounge, and fully immerse themselves in the music. The lighting was warm and intentional creating a balance between calm and electric energy that allowed each performance to resonate on a deeper level.

This was not about spectacle. It was about presence. Every detail was designed to bring people closer — to the music, to the artists, and to each other. It reimagined what a live music experience could feel like when authenticity takes the lead.

A Platform for Alternative African Voices
A Platform for Alternative African Voices

At its core, The Mango Farm exists to spotlight a new wave of African artists shaping the Neo Soul and R&B landscape. Moments like the debut performance of Uzulumarvingae delivered alongside the Babble Hume band — captured the essence of what this platform stands for: raw talent, artistic bravery, and meaningful storytelling.

These are artists who exist outside of the mainstream, yet carry the depth and richness of African expression in powerful ways. By creating space for these voices, The Mango Farm is not only showcasing talent it is actively shaping the future sound of African music.


Growing Through Support, Mentorship & Community
Growing Through Support, Mentorship & Community

BAI Foundation played a key role in supporting The Mango Farm’s journey, providing both financial backing and developmental guidance as the team executed their first independent edition at New Centre. This milestone — celebrated as part of their one-year anniversary — marked a significant step in their evolution from a growing idea into a fully realised cultural experience.

Beyond funding, the partnership reflects BAI’s commitment to nurturing youth-led initiatives that are building culture from the ground up. Through mentorship and collaboration, projects like The Mango Farm are able to scale their vision, deepen their impact, and reach wider audiences.

As the platform continues to grow, it stands as a testament to what happens when young creatives are given the resources, trust, and space to lead. The seeds planted here are not only flourishing — they are lighting the way for others.
